What is Micro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ll?

A DLL file, or Dynamic Link Library, is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. Specifically, the micro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ll file is a DLL file related to the software Forefront Identity Manager 2010. This DLL file plays a crucial role in providing resources and functionality for the Forefront Identity Manager 2010 software to work properly.

The micro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ll file is important because it contains essential resources and code that the Forefront Identity Manager 2010 software relies on to perform its identity management functions effectively. Without this DLL file, the software may not be able to function properly, which could lead to issues with managing user identities and access within an organization's computer systems.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• The file micro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
  • Micro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.
  • Cannot register micro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ll: This suggests that the DLL file could not be registered by the system, possibly due to inconsistencies or errors in the Windows Registry. Another reason might be that the DLL file is not in the correct directory or is missing.
  • Micro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).
  • Micro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ll could not be loaded: This error indicates that the DLL file, necessary for certain operations, couldn't be loaded by the system. Potential causes might include missing DLL files, DLL files that are not properly registered in the system, or conflicts with other software.

Perform a Clean Boot

Perform a Clean Boot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
13
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
7
Description

How to perform a clean boot. This can isolate the issue with micro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ll and help resolve the problem.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the microsoft.identitymanagement.client.office2010.resources.dll problem persists.
